In Biblical conception, God is a living God
who shows himself to mankind in different ways and in the first
two chapters of Genesis the various stages of creation are
described.
God created everything in a certain order.
His focus is on mankind and he gave mankind dominance over the
earth and all living things.
Starting in the Old Testament God is
described of having a special bond with the Israelites as a
King, Creator, and Shepherd. Their God is a mother and as a
husband as well as The God of all human kind to Israel. They
called him Yahweh! He showed himself to Moses as a Burning Bush.
(Exodus 3:1-4) When God was asked who he was, God
replied, “I AM the Great I AM.” Later on God Spoke to Moses like
a Man with his friend” . When Moses wanted to see God, God told
Moses that no man would be able to see his countenance because
he would not be able to live. On Mount Sinai, God showed himself
to the Israelites in the form of thunder and earth quakes.
Further reading in Exodus shows God as their savior. God rescued
the Israelites from the Egyptian slavery.
